Behave Flow

screenshot of Behave Flow
react
tailwind

a ui for behave-graph using react-flow

Overview

Behave Flow is an innovative user interface designed for editing behaviour graphs with ease, utilizing the power of react-flow. This tool aims to simplify the complex process of managing behaviour graphs, making it accessible for developers and designers alike. With its active development status, users can anticipate frequent updates and improvements as the creators refine functionality and user experience.

Features

  • User-Friendly Interface: Designed with accessibility in mind, Behave Flow offers an intuitive layout that makes graph editing straightforward for users of all skill levels.
  • React-Flow Integration: Seamlessly built on react-flow technology, ensuring smooth performance and responsiveness when manipulating behaviour graphs.
  • Active Development: Regular updates and improvements mean that users can expect new features and bug fixes to continually enhance their experience.
  • Real-Time Collaboration: Facilitates collaborative work where multiple users can edit and view changes in real time, promoting team dynamics in projects.
  • Customizable Elements: Users can modify graph components to fit their specific needs, allowing for flexibility in different project scenarios.
  • Live Demo Available: Interested users can explore a live demonstration to get a firsthand look at the current functionalities and design of Behave Flow.
  • Community Feedback: Encourages user input to influence future updates, fostering a community-centric approach in development.
react
React

React is a widely used JavaScript library for building user interfaces and single-page applications. It follows a component-based architecture and uses a virtual DOM to efficiently update and render UI components

tailwind
Tailwind

Tailwind CSS is a utility-first CSS framework that provides pre-defined classes for building responsive and customizable user interfaces.

postcss
Postcss

PostCSS is a popular open-source tool that enables web developers to transform CSS styles with JavaScript plugins. It allows for efficient processing of CSS styles, from applying vendor prefixes to improving browser compatibility, ultimately resulting in cleaner, faster, and more maintainable code.

typescript
Typescript

TypeScript is a superset of JavaScript, providing optional static typing, classes, interfaces, and other features that help developers write more maintainable and scalable code. TypeScript's static typing system can catch errors at compile-time, making it easier to build and maintain large applications.